Synopsis "I Am a Leftover from World War 2: A Memoir"
World War II may have ended in Europe on May 8th, 1945, but for some Holocaust Survivors and their children, it never did. For Renee Antar's mother, the specter of Hitler and his Nazi's followed her from Holland to New York City and was the defining feature of the next seven decades for her and her family's life. In this brutally frank and candid memoir the author describes the personal hell of growing up under the shadow of a mother tortured by both mental illness and the recurring horrors of The Holocaust.(Please Note: This book is for adults only. It contains foul and coarse language plus dialogue and scenes that may be disturbing to some people)
